When we have our first taste of the New World, is nice and welcoming. This happened to those of us in the Activation of the Ninth Gate to Bali in October when we opened the door to the New World. Then when we step deeper into the New World, we experience a massive off the old that is similar to travel through a Black Hole This immersion in the New World is not kind. It 'more like being pushed into a barrier space / time. We are thrown out of the map known.
 
 
Once you arrive on the shores of the New World, we are in a state of shock. It is not because the New World is not a good place or a place where we do not want to be. And 'the shock of being in a completely different environment and the shock of no longer being on the old map where family knew how to apply our skills and knowledge are well developed and where we knew where everything was located.
 
At first, there are no anchor points are many in our New World.Sometimes it is useful to create small islands of the family, especially when we are in an area largely unknown. We can find comfort in the small tasks of daily living such as making breakfast or washing clothes. We can create a small space with items that are personally sacred to us. Then, as our new life will evolve, we will begin to make new friends, find a favorite restaurant and align ourselves with the nature of our new healthy environment.
 
In the New World, our attitudes change and we begin to do things that we've never done before. As a personal example: I never wore a watch on a regular basis for my entire life. I've only worn one when I was traveling by plane. Now, I'm living in Peru, where one might think that a watch is not necessary, but suddenly I'm wearing one all the time! And I am finding it very useful ....
 
As soon as we arrive in our new world, we must be extremely vigilant not to fall into our old reactions and automatic responses. In fact, if we do, will keep us from living fully in the New World. We must stop looking at things with old mindsets and opinions because they simply no longer true.
 
Some of us are moving to entirely new physical environments in which nothing is as it was before. Do not be surprised if things do not immediately click into place when you arrive. It can be uncomfortable and embarrassing at first, because our new world requires a new level of skills and adaptations. We are pushed into a very steep learning curve. But it is also extremely helpful when our New World is so different that we can not do almost everything the same way as before. Our new world may require that we speak a different language, that interact with a very different culture, that we are not able to find the foods that we usually eat. This makes it much easier to get out of our old patterns, because our old patterns are impossible to maintain an environment so different.
 
Other environment does not change by switching to a new location, but changed their way of life in their current position.We will all have the opportunity to change our way of life. Some of these may come from what was previously considered as unfortunate circumstances, such as the loss of a job, a natural disaster or the end of a relationship. All these events simply close the door on the old and give us the opportunity to open a new door to a more fulfilling life.
 
Sometimes, this can bring out the fear of losing our old master - and it is true that the loss. However, we also have the opportunity to develop mastery in totally new areas. The result is like a treasure hunt continues, as we cross the maze collect the necessary information, establish useful contacts and learn what we need at that time. If we had traveled in a direct and linear, we would have lost this experience necessary.
 
We know we need to keep open, but sometimes it just becomes an empty concept and put it into practice. My openness to new and unexpected things that take me beyond my comfort zone has been put to the test every day. I consider myself quite open, but I'm finding more situations where they are not. This is a very effective lesson. For example, I searched for the right house to live because I moved to Peru in early November. I spent my first weeks in a hotel, then I found a house to rent. The owner of this house will come in a week so I need to find a new place to live very soon.
 
It 's easy for me to see this labyrinthine journey in my new home as a difficulty or be confused about why that took me straight to it. At times I thought I did something wrong. Yet, I now realize that every step of my trip was extremely valuable. I have spoken with so many new people in my search for a home. Along the way I made some good friends and I learned a lot from my experiences with them. If I had just moved directly into my house when I arrived in Peru, I spent most of my time there and I would have lost these valuable experiences, the necessary information and new connections.
